Phoenix is a layer 1 and layer 2 blockchain infrastructure, empowering intelligent Web3 applications. It focuses on the next generation of AI & Privacy-Enabled Web3 Apps. Phoenix (PHB) is a cryptocurrency that operates on the BNB Smart Chain (BEP20) platform.
